Can I upgrade the firmware on the ipod touch to the newest one?
Yes
What is the newest firmware version?
1.1.4, 2.0 is out in June
Do I need to jailbreak my ipod touch?
No you don't NEED to, but you can if you want, and to be honest I'd hang on until June for the App Store in v2.0 to see if you still want the jailbreak.
What does the jailbreak do for the ipod touch?
Lets you install non Apple applications.
I'm looking at dot tunes to stream my library on my mac to my ipod, do I need to jailbreak my ipod to do this?
No - see here for starters Dot.Tunes

Also,
If you want the upgrade to get the iPhone apps that came alongside 1.1.3 (Mail, Notes, Google Maps, Weather, Stocks) you'll have to pay $19.99 to get them. The system update to 1.1.3 was free, the applications were extra. There may be another charge in June to get the App Store too.
